Botanical Interests Black Velvet Nasturtium Seeds

Impressive 'Black Velvet' will have the other garden flowers whispering in amazement! These edible beauties add glamorous, ruby-black color to salads and cheese plates, as well as creating eye-catching displays in gardens.

Sowing Information:

  • Light: Full sun to part shade
  • When to Sow Outside: RECOMMENDED. 1 to 2 weeks after your average last frost date.
  • When to Start Inside: Not recommended. 2 to 4 weeks before your average last frost date. The roots are sensitive to transplant disturbance; sow in biodegradable pots that can be directly planted in the ground.
  • Days to Emerge: 7–14 days
  • Seed Depth: Â½â€“1 inch
  • Seed Spacing: A group of 3 seeds every 8–12 inches
  • Thinning: When 2 inches tall, thin to 1 every 8–12 inches

Growing Notes:

  • Hardiness: Frost-sensitive, tender perennial usually grown as an annual
  • Variety Information: 2"–2½"ruby-black blooms
  • Bloom Period: Late spring to frost
  • Attributes: Attracts pollinators, deer resistant, drought-tolerant, edible flower, rabbit resistant
